Maintenance of the water supply network
Within the scope of the scheduled and preventive maintenance the openness of valves and fire hydrants are checked, they are repaired and replaced if needed, and dilapidated network sections and connections are replaced.
Interventional maintenance covers the elimination of failures in the network due to subsidence, corrosion, mechanical damages and the like.
Efficiency and speed are fundamental in the maintenance of the water supply network in order to minimize stoppages in water supply to the least possible measure. Therefore, we organised an intervention team on duty all around the clock, who, from the moment the failure has been reported to the Dispatcher Service at phone no. 55 – 77 – 11, can get to the site within minutes and eliminate the breakdown at any time of the day during the whole year.
By the EPANET computer programme the pipeline’s hydraulic behaviour is simulated. The whole supply network is under permanent control; we continuously measure pressure on several network points, which is the precondition of supervision and elimination of breakdowns.
System water lossesare also monitored with the aim to minimize them. The most frequent causes of water loss are defective installations, dilapidated connection and water quantities used for the necessary flush of the supply pipeline thus providing that it meets sanitary requirements.

Special Equipment Used by the Water Supply Department
Correlator – a modern and effective equipment, which on the principles of acoustics and radio signals provides a diagnosis of the supply network’s condition, accurate detection of failures and reliable registering of all connections.

Loggers – modern and accurate equipment used for collecting data on the supply network and which provides pressure monitoring.
